Output fffc3e1c31eca33929039bfa492756a0585dc531cba250dc75c2720483e0b6a1:24

value
186083
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af7cf4c1d93ba462fee16a3a2b7899c52d1bc592 OP_EQUAL
address
3HgusDRFwwRRsJJ4rDvxX8xtcxTdr3iTtv
transaction
fffc3e1c31eca33929039bfa492756a0585dc531cba250dc75c2720483e0b6a1
confirmations
316530
spent
true